Synthesis of Tritium Labeled Compounds Using Fibroid Carbon Carrier

Abstract

The results of tritium labeling of organic compounds by solid phase catalysis using multi-walls carbon nanotubes were compared with one obtained by using activated carbon purchased from “Norit”. It was found that utilization of multi-walls carbon nanotubes lead to considerable growth of the yield (10–20 times) and molar radioactivity (1.5–2 times) of labeled compounds. Using such carrier it became possible to obtain tritium labeled biological active compound like diazepam, etomidat, proline, phenylalanine with molar radioactivity 10–25 Ci/mmol
